[Transcriptional regulation of plant genes and its significance in biology]

Yi Chuan. 2007 Jul;29(7):793-9. doi: 10.1360/yc-007-0793.
[Article in Chinese]

Abstract

A change of gene expression pattern, especially at a transcriptional level, is one of the most important motivities for plant variation. In this study, the modes of gene transcriptional regulation in plant were systematically described from genetics and epigenetics aspects, respectively, as well as their significances to plant divergence and evolution. Based on the current knowledge, the prospects, applications and problems in this area were analyzed.
